Football Transfers: Isak, Rabiot, Pavard – Latest News

European soccer’s transfer window slammed shut wiht some blockbuster deals shaking up the landscape. Liverpool landed Swedish striker Alexander Isak from Newcastle for a reported €150 million, possibly setting a new benchmark for transfers between English clubs. Meanwhile, Adrien Rabiot has officially joined AC Milan from Olympique Marseille (OM), who in turn welcomed back 2018 World Cup winner Benjamin Pavard from Inter Milan.

Serie A Shuffle: Rabiot to Milan, Pavard Returns to Marseille

Across the continent, Serie A also witnessed meaningful movement. Adrien Rabiot, a seasoned midfielder with a knack for dictating play, has officially signed with AC Milan. This acquisition strengthens Milan’s midfield and adds valuable experience to their squad as they look to challenge for the Scudetto.

Simultaneously occurring, Olympique Marseille (OM) orchestrated a homecoming, bringing back Benjamin Pavard, a key member of France’s 2018 World Cup-winning squad, from Inter Milan. Pavard’s versatility and defensive prowess will undoubtedly solidify OM’s backline and provide a significant boost to their title aspirations. Pavard’s return is a massive coup for OM, said one Ligue 1 analyst. He brings a winning mentality and a wealth of experience to the team.

Draft Lottery Shakes Up the MLB Landscape

The MLB Draft Lottery, now in its third year, continues to inject unpredictability into the league’s offseason. Similar to the NBA Draft Lottery, this system aims to discourage tanking by giving teams with the worst records only the best *chance* at the top pick, not a guarantee. This year, the Nationals, despite not having the worst record in baseball, emerged victorious, proving that any team can win the lottery.

Following the Nationals, the Los Angeles angels and Seattle Mariners will select second and third, respectively [[1]].These teams, also looking to bolster their rosters with young talent, will have prime opportunities to select impact players.

Storm Steal Sykes: Seattle Lands All-Star Guard in Blockbuster Trade

The Seattle Storm are making waves in the WNBA,solidifying their contender status with the acquisition of All-Star guard Brittney Sykes from the Washington Mystics. In a move that sent shockwaves through the league, the Storm snagged Sykes in exchange for alysha Clark, zia Cooke, and a 2026 first-round draft pick [[2]]. This trade, finalized before the 2025 trade deadline [[1]], signals seattle’s all-in approach to competing for a championship.

Sykes Brings Scoring Punch to Seattle

Brittney Sykes, known for her aggressive drives to the basket and tenacious defense, averaged an notable 15.4 points per game for the Mystics [[2]]. Her ability to create her own shot and disrupt opposing offenses makes her a valuable addition to a Storm team already boasting considerable talent. Think of her as the WNBA’s version of jrue Holiday – a two-way player who elevates the performance of everyone around her.

What the Storm Gave Up

While the acquisition of Sykes is undoubtedly a coup for Seattle, it came at a price. Alysha Clark, a veteran forward known for her perimeter shooting and defensive versatility, will be missed. Zia cooke, a promising young guard, also heads to Washington, along with a coveted first-round pick in the 2026 draft. The Storm are betting that Sykes’ immediate impact outweighs the potential of future assets. This is a classic “win-now” move, reminiscent of the Los Angeles Lakers trading for anthony Davis to pair with LeBron James.
